Transaction ed893eca6105b5bf07cfe41a3068c01b9f0095456d78934cbabc8443aa71d79f
1 Input
1 Output
-
ed893eca6105b5bf07cfe41a3068c01b9f0095456d78934cbabc8443aa71d79f:0
- value
- 16465044
- script pubkey
- OP_0 OP_PUSHBYTES_20 66ee2866509fab7535665d35a3a1ad7f12ba9e16
- address
- bc1qvmhzsejsn74h2dtxt5668gdd0uft48sk9p6ces